You’re probably already paying for this
Microsoft 365 Business Standard and Premium include SharePoint — the same platform enterprises run on. Most companies never set it up, because it ships as an empty box.
We do the part that turns it into something your team will actually use: structure, permissions, migration, and training.

Frequently asked questions
Do we need new licenses?
Usually not. If you’re on Microsoft 365 Business Standard or Premium, SharePoint is already included in what you pay today.
How is this different from just using OneDrive?
OneDrive is personal storage. SharePoint is shared, structured, permissioned company storage — the difference between your files and the company’s files.
Can you move us off our file server?
Yes. Migrating from an on-premise file server or a mix of cloud drives is one of the most common projects we run.
What counts as a “custom app”?
Usually something small and specific: a job intake form, an equipment log, a request tracker — the things a business runs on spreadsheets today.
